Knowing you have Executive Debt is one thing. Knowing how to reduce it? That’s where leadership gets real.

In this final chapter, we move from diagnosis to execution. You’ll learn the five-step framework leaders can use to reduce Executive Debt across any organization—starting today.

1. Diagnose

Use the Executive Debt Scorecard to identify your biggest gaps. Focus on Cultural, Strategic, Operational, Talent, and Market-related debt.

Tip: Don’t do this alone. Get input from your leadership team for a full-spectrum view.

2. Prioritize

Not all debts are equally dangerous. Start with the ones that:

  • Threaten current performance
  • Block future growth
  • Undermine leadership trust

Tip: Look for quick wins you can tackle fast, while planning for long-term shifts.

3. Engage

Bring your team into the conversation. Share the concept of Executive Debt. Discuss your findings. Make it safe to surface hidden issues.

Tip: Leaders go first. Model vulnerability and accountability.

4. Monitor

Use quarterly check-ins to assess progress. Revisit your scorecard. Keep the conversation alive.

Tip: Tie debt reduction to KPIs. If it matters, it should be measured.

5. Lead

Make this part of how you lead—not just a one-time initiative. Build Executive Debt awareness into onboarding, reviews, and planning cycles.

Tip: Use your own story to inspire others. Leaders who admit past missteps build future trust.

Why This Matters:

Executive Debt doesn’t fix itself. But with the right framework, any leadership team can reduce it, reverse its effects, and build a culture of clarity and courage.
